Handover: webhook retries — Tollgate dispatcher

Welcome aboard. Tollgate retries failed webhook deliveries with exponential backoff plus jitter; 410 responses permanently disable an endpoint, everything else retries up to the cap. Dead-lettered events land in the replay queue, which ops drains weekly. Don't change the backoff curve without flagging the Harwick team first. The dispatcher's current retry configuration is as follows.

config for kafof-bawef:
holath:
  log_level: debug
  metrics_host: metrics.holath.qorvelsys.internal
  pin: 2191
  pool_size: 32

**Runbook: Account recovery — tailctl access**

This fragment covers recovering operator accounts for tailctl, the internal CLI used at Varrowfield for log tailing. When an operator is locked out, recovery restores read-only tailing scopes first; write scopes require separate approval. All recovery actions are logged to the Greyhenge audit stream for review. Reviewers should confirm that session tokens rotate on recovery. Initiating the recovery flow from a trusted host requires the passphrase recorded immediately below.

strongbox words: raleth-ralvan-aldiel-ulaax-istix-zorok-kelax-kelox-wenix-zormir-aldix-silael-normir

Handover note — dispatch desk, from Teo to Priya

Hey Priya, quick rundown before I'm off. The Halloway Street office move kicks off Thursday, and dispatch is coordinating the two van runs to the new Quillbridge site. Movers from Strideline arrive at 7:30; give them the dock keys from the grey cabinet. The archive boxes marked with orange tape go on the second run only — finance was very insistent. One more thing you'll need for the sealed crate: the courier hand-over instruction is below.

dispatch memo: the eliok quenok courier leaves the sorael aldath belion tammir casix gileth queniel jorath ledger at gate 9299 under passcode 897989

Ticket: EXIF scrubbing misses thumbnail metadata in Pindrop uploads

The scrubber in Pindrop's media pipeline strips top-level EXIF correctly, but embedded thumbnail blocks retain GPS and timestamp tags. Repro: upload any JPEG from the Harlow test set, then inspect the stored copy — thumbnail IFD survives intact. Proposed fix rewrites the thumbnail after scrubbing rather than copying it verbatim. Please review the diff carefully around offset handling. The failing build is referenced below.

build token for kagaf-hahof: htk14_9d3d4d26d7d8de